HLE Glascoat Limited (HLEGLAS.NS) traded at ₹319.75 on the National Stock Exchange, marking a decline of 2.50% from its previous close. The stock is currently testing intermediate support near its established level of ₹303.76, while resistance remains at ₹335.74.

Volume during the session on both NSE and BSE appeared consistent with normal trading activity, without any significant spike indicating panic selling or accumulation. The stock’s movement seems driven largely by broad sectoral weakness in the industrial machinery space, as profit booking emerged after a recent modest uptick. HLE Glascoat operates in the surface coating and engineering solutions segment, which has faced margin pressure from rising raw material costs. The decline of ₹319.75 from a prior close of approximately ₹328.00 reflects a pullback of about 2.50%. Traders are closely watching whether the stock can hold above the support level of ₹303.76, a zone that has historically attracted buying interest. The price action suggests a phase of consolidation as the stock attempts to stabilise after the session’s losses. From a technical perspective, HLE Glascoat is hovering near the lower boundary of its recent trading range. Key support is placed at ₹303.76, a level derived from previous swing lows and may act as a floor in the near term. On the upside, resistance at ₹335.74 has capped advances in recent weeks; a sustained move above this level would signal renewed bullish momentum. The stock’s short-term moving averages are showing a slight bearish crossover, with the 20-day moving average trending below the 50-day average. Momentum indicators—such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I)—are likely in the mid‑40s, indicating neither overbought nor oversold conditions. The price pattern resembles a descending channel, suggesting that sellers maintain a slight edge. A close below ₹303.76 could open the door for further downside towards the ₹290–₹295 zone, while a bounce from current levels may lead to a retest of the ₹325‑₹330 area. Going forward, HLE Glascoat’s price trajectory may depend on broader market sentiment and sector‑specific triggers. A decisive break above resistance at ₹335.74 would suggest that the recent pullback was a healthy correction and could attract fresh buying interest. Conversely, if selling pressure intensifies and the stock slips below the ₹303.76 support, it could potentially test the next major support band around ₹280–₹285. Factors that may influence performance include quarterly earnings announcements, order book updates, and fluctuations in input costs. Market participants are advised to monitor volume patterns closely—any unusually high volume near support levels could indicate institutional activity. The stock’s ability to hold above its 200‑day moving average (approximately ₹300) will be critical for medium‑term stability. In the absence of fresh positive catalysts, sideways consolidation may persist in the near term.
